Oaks and the Apennines: Truffle Cultivation, Heritage Foods, Sustainability and Well-being in Italy

Research output: Other contribution

Abstract

A compelling account of life and food in the Apennine Mountains, Central Italy. This book offers invaluable technical information on truffles and theory regarding their cultivation, together with a fascinating narration of the experiences, history and cultures of inhabitants within the Sibillini Mountains. The author explores the ecological and culinary knowledge and practices of people of this area of Central Italy, guiding the reader with historical records, contemporary ethnographic accounts, and political-economic framing, through this mountain region which she knows so intimately, into the complex and multifaceted world of nature-first truffle farming.
